Chapter 3 Committees The CommitteeonRules of Procedure reviews theCouncil's Rules of Procedure ("RoP") and the committee system, as well as proposes any amendments or changes it considers necessary to the Council. Committee on Rules of Procedure Hon Paul TSE Wai-chun, Chairman of the Committee on Rules of Procedure. Hon Kenneth LEUNG, Deputy Chairman of the Committee on Rules of Procedure. Chairman Hon Paul TSEWai-chun Deputy Chairman Hon Kenneth LEUNG No. of members 12 [  Membership list] No. of meetings held 3 (closed meetings) Major work • In accordance with the majority view in its consultation with all Members, the Committee had proposed amendments to RoP to require Members running for the office of President to make a statutory declaration on their nationality and residency status. Such amendments were approved by the Council on 20 February 2019; • Arising from earlier amendments to RoP which empower the Clerk to the Legislative Council ("the Clerk") to conduct the election of the President, the Committee had proposed consequential amendments to the House Rules in relation to the date and venue of the election or re-election of the President as well as the role and power of the Clerk.
